1、NoMachine
简介:NoMachine是一款远程桌面工具,其NX协议在高延迟低带宽的链路上提供了近乎本地速度的响应能力。
功能特性:可以处理文档、音乐和视频等任何内容,就好像用户在自己的电脑跟前处理那样,还支持共享文档、驱动器共享等功能。
使用场景:适用于远程管理移动员工,想获得标准的桌面体验,实施瘦客户机场景以降低电脑采购成本。
安装与运行:支持Linux、Windows、Mac OS X,甚至安卓系统,安装过程相对简单,只需下载一个文件,不同系统有不同的安装格式。
建立连接:安装完成后,通过开始菜单或CLI启动,第一次运行时有向导程序帮助配置连接,需输入连接名称、主机、协议和端口等信息,然后验证主机真实性并提供登录所需的用户资料。
2、RustDesk
简介:一款开源的自托管远程桌面应用程序,用Rust编程语言编写,具备快速、可靠的特性。
功能特性:强调用户对数据的全权控制,可选择使用集成的中转服务器或自建、定制中转服务器,支持即开即用、多平台,还提供文件传输、TCP隧道等功能。
使用场景:适用于企业远程支持、远程办公、数据备份和恢复、学习与培训等场景。
安装与运行:从GitHub发布页面获取适合系统的安装包,下载后直接运行应用程序,打开软件后输入要连接的远程设备的ID和密码即可开始远程控制。
3、Windows自带远程桌面功能结合公网IP
简介:利用Windows系统自带的远程桌面功能,结合被控端电脑的公网IP地址来实现非局域网远程连接。
功能特性:简单易行,无需额外安装软件,可直接使用Windows系统的功能进行远程操作。
使用场景:适用于Windows系统之间的远程连接,且被控端电脑有公网IP地址的情况。
设置步骤:在被控端电脑上启用远程桌面连接(在“系统属性”中设置),并获取其公网IP地址;在控制端电脑上使用“mstsc”命令打开远程桌面连接,输入被控端的公网IP地址和登录凭证,即可进行远程操作。
4、Chrome Remote Desktop
简介:由Google提供的基于Chrome浏览器的远程桌面解决方案。
功能特性:无需额外安装软件,只需在两台电脑上安装Chrome浏览器,并登录相同的Google账户即可实现远程连接。
使用场景:适合临时或紧急情况下的远程协作,操作简便。
设置步骤:在被控端电脑上,访问Chrome Remote Desktop官网并设置允许远程连接;在控制端电脑上,同样访问该官网,选择被控端电脑进行连接。
不经过服务器的远程桌面技术多种多样,它们各自具有独特的优势和适用场景,无论是追求高速稳定连接的NoMachine,还是注重数据安全和自托管能力的RustDesk,亦或是利用Windows自带功能和Chrome浏览器的便捷性,用户都可以根据自己的需求选择合适的远程桌面解决方案。